Reform the processes of arranging a funeral / collecting ashes

What the petition asks
I think that, as well as the green form, an additional step should be added to the process of requesting a cremation, collecting ashes and arranging a funeral. This should be to prove that the person arranging the funeral or collecting the ashes is the next of kin or executor of the will.
I don't think that the green form and death certificate should be sufficient proof to confirm someone has the right to collect ashes or organise a funeral. This will prevent families being caused distress by not being able to rightfully collect and bury ashes of a loved one.
